Output 30f332e0333c666786f433957b3cb33dd3658d664103d3a148462b4f5ae8be60:6

value
517492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e804a232597c639169186ac7d4c29df5a30907d OP_EQUALVERIFY OP_CHECKSIG
address
1B5H1pVukn8KjBEiE7ZLDGAVvL34kGu7iG
transaction
30f332e0333c666786f433957b3cb33dd3658d664103d3a148462b4f5ae8be60
spent
true